Listing your items on eBay can be very confusing if you don`t know where to start. Here are a few tips on getting your items listed so that they sell.

Accuracy

When you list your items on eBay, write an accurate description. You do not have to write long paragraphs of rambling information but provide exact measurements, colors, condition, etc. Be extremely precise when it comes to your description.

Auction Title

Just as using a strong title for a boook, your eBay auction title needs to captivate buyers. You are allowed 45 characters for your title and you need to use common words that will draw attention. Use this space carefully and to your advantage. Think of words that will be easily found when people conduct a search. For example, if you are selling six yards of fabric you could say something like, ?Stunning material ? Don?t miss this great bargain.? If you are selling fishing poles, try something like, ?Love to fish? GREAT buy on fishing poles!?
